This robot moves just like a human, but that’s about it – Strictly Robots Share December 3, 2021 Dm4r Technology Ameca is an incredibly lifelike humanoid robot designed by Engineered Arts. While fluid in its motion and capable of creating some seriously impressive facial expressions, its technology falls short. Source : This robot moves just like a human, but that’s about it – Strictly Robots